The World's 10 Most Valuable Brands

RANK       BRAND             2001 BRAND
                          VALUE ($BILLIONS)


1 COCA-COLA 68.9 2 MICROSOFT 65.1 3 IBM 52.8 4 GE 42.4 5 NOKIA 35.0 6 INTEL 34.7 7 DISNEY 32.6 8 FORD 30.1 9 McDONALD'S 25.3 10 AT&T 22.8



Data: Interbrand, Citigroup
